What is the average price of a house in Didsbury East, Manchester?

The average price for a house in Didsbury East, Manchester is £447k, costing on average £470 per sqft.

Average prices of houses by bedroom count are: £277k for a two-bedroom, £376k for a three-bedroom, £566k for a four-bedroom, and £794k for a five-bedroom.

What share of houses in Didsbury East, Manchester feature gardens and parking?

In Didsbury East, Manchester, 95% of houses have a garden and 77% include parking.

What is the breakdown of property types in Didsbury East, Manchester?

The housing mix in Didsbury East, Manchester is 11% detached, 58% semi-detached, 30% terraced, and 1% other.

What is the most expensive area in Didsbury East, Manchester to buy a home?

The most expensive area to buy a house in Didsbury East, Manchester is M20, where the average property is £541k. The second and third most expensive areas are SK4 with an average price of £475k and M19 with an average price of £325k .

What is the average price of a flat in Didsbury East, Manchester?

The average price for a flat in Didsbury East, Manchester is £215k, costing on average £373 per sqft.

Average prices of flats by bedroom count are: £153k for a one-bedroom, £232k for a two-bedroom, £305k for a three-bedroom, and N/A for a four-bedroom.

What share of flats in Didsbury East, Manchester feature balconies and parking?

In Didsbury East, Manchester, 16% of flats have a balcony and 87% include parking.

What is the breakdown of lease types in Didsbury East, Manchester?

The leasing mix in Didsbury East, Manchester is 98% leasehold and 2% freehold.

What is the most expensive area in Didsbury East, Manchester to buy a flat?

The most expensive area to buy a flat in Didsbury East, Manchester is M20, where the average property is £284k. The second and third most expensive areas are SK4 with an average price of £220k and M19 with an average price of £141k .
